Development and Engineering

The aesthetics and engineering of a high-performance vehicle are pivotal in transforming an visionary concept into a breathtaking reality. At the core of every supercar is a singular design that reflects both visual allure and aerodynamic efficiency. Designers meticulously balance serving the eye with functionality, ensuring that each contour and edge contributes to the vehicle's performance. These artistic choices not only enhance beauty but also optimize airflow and vehicle stability, essential factors in achieving high speeds.

Once the initial sketches are approved, the technical team steps in to turn these ideas into tangible parts. They utilize cutting-edge materials such as carbon fiber and aluminum to create light structures that enhance speed and agility. Precise measurements and simulations are conducted to address the car's dynamics, from suspension setup to braking mechanisms. This combination of novel engineering techniques is crucial for crafting a supercar that meets the rigorous demands of performance enthusiasts.

Additionally, the development of a supercar involves cutting-edge technology, including hybrid powertrains and sophisticated electronics. Engineers extend the limits of what is possible by incorporating features such as adaptive aerodynamics and dynamic torque vectoring. These innovations not only improve the driving experience but also ensure that the supercar remains at the leading edge of automotive innovation. The collaboration between design and engineering is crucial, allowing the supercar to stand out as a emblem of speed, power, and futuristic technology.

Performance

The performance of a supercar is defined not just by raw power, but by the harmonious blend of mechanical prowess and aesthetics. Each element, from the aerodynamics to the suspension, plays a vital role in achieving exceptional speed and maneuverability. Supercars often feature high-output engines that produce astounding horsepower, allowing them to accelerate from zero to 60 miles per hour in mere seconds. Coupled with advanced materials like carbon fiber and aluminum, these vehicles are designed to be lightweight yet highly durable, enhancing both performance and efficiency.

Testing is an integral part of the supercar development process. Manufacturers often push their test models to the limit under various conditions to ensure they can perform at optimal capacity. This includes speed tests on racetracks, where engineers assess responsiveness and control, as well as practical driving scenarios to evaluate daily performance. Moreover, thorough safety tests are conducted to protect both drivers and passengers, ensuring that the car not only performs well but also meets and exceeds industry safety standards.

The final phase of testing often involves refining the car based on input from professional drivers. This refinement process allows engineers to refine aspects such as acceleration sensitivity, braking performance, and suspension settings. The goal is to create a supercar that not only excels in performance metrics but also provides an exhilarating driving experience. Through this meticulous journey of performance and testing, the concept of a supercar transforms into a real masterpiece on the road.
